Whether you have a small, medium, or large business – or want to resell web hosting – Microsoft Azure’s cloud computing platform can handle it all.
But its pricing model can be a bit daunting and confusing with there being hundreds of (sometimes redundant) options.
Something to keep in mind, also, is that
Microsoft Azure offers many time-limited free services and 40+ always-free services. Examples of these include 64GB persistent storage disks, and a Linux or Windows B1s virtual machine which you can use to set up your first web server.
Azure’s free service also comes with a $200 credit that you can apply towards different paid products like larger persistent storage disks and more bandwidth. This is helpful if you want to try out Azure, but don’t necessarily want to commit fully just yet.
This article will go through several pricing options and configurations to help you figure out what features you need without spending money on features you don’t. Azure is a complex platform that requires a fair amount of advanced server configuration and web development knowledge and experience, so I’ve also
suggested some alternatives.
Microsoft Azure Features and Pricing Overview
Microsoft Azure’s prices are comparable to other similar cloud computing and hosting providers. This type of provider doesn’t offer traditional hosting plans, so you’ll need some advanced tech knowledge (or have someone on staff who does) in order to configure your server from the ground up.
This can be complicated, but the good news is,
the price can be adjusted more finely. You’ll have the flexibility to get exactly what you need without overpaying.
Something to consider is the temporary storage that’s included with the VM(s) you choose.
Whatever is stored on temporary disks is not permanent and will be erased if you restart your virtual machine. The temporary disks are generally reserved for page or swap files only. If you want to store data long-term, you’ll have to add a persistent storage disk which will incur an additional cost.
Accepted payment methods include credit card, wire transfer, or check. But don’t break out your wallet just yet! Remember those free services I told you about? Microsoft Azure offers many time-limited free services for 12 months, or 750 hours (whichever comes first).
These temporarily-free services include a B1s Linux or Windows burstable virtual machine that can be used to host a website, and two 64GB persistent SSDs that allow you to store files like text, images, and videos.
The $200 credit that you get along with your free services is valid for 30 days, and can be applied towards upgraded persistent storage, or even a different server instance entirely.
Azure also gives you access to several always-free services. These include Microsoft Defender for Cloud which can prevent malicious activity on your servers, and Azure Advisor which can help you optimize your server infrastructure.
Cloud Hosting
Cloud hosting is highly scalable and can support anything from small, single-page websites to large organizations, and even reseller operations with multiple websites. The best thing about this type of hosting is, if you’re careful and plan ahead, you really only pay for what you actually need and use.
However, choosing the right server instance is complicated. To help you with the selection process,
here are four different tiers of virtual machines I’d like to draw your attention to.
B-series virtual machines allow you to keep your costs low while your website isn’t getting much traffic, but also have the ability to “burst” (boost) its performance when your site gets spikes in traffic.
But bursting is only meant to be temporary. If you spend some time using fewer resources than your quota, you build up credit – and when you go over your quota, it depletes your credit. You’ll know you have chosen the right B-series virtual machine if you always have at least a little bit of credit.
The B1Is burstable server instance is the cheapest that Microsoft Azure offers. This would be suitable for a small web server hosting a site that receives periodic bumps in traffic, like a blog that reviews popular new products or a news site that posts breaking news items.
You should upgrade to a general-purpose, A-series VM if you notice that these periodic surges turn into consistent traffic. Any one of the A-series VMs (covered below) would be a better option in that case.
B2ms is a memory-optimized virtual machine meant to serve a lot of simultaneous processes.
With B2ms, your RAM increases to 16GB, but you keep the same number of CPU cores. Whereas B1ls is ideal for very small web servers with infrequent traffic surges, B2ms is valuable for websites that need to have many processes running simultaneously.
A forum site with a lot of people signing up and posting and replying to comments, or an online store with frequent sale announcements, could be served well by the B2ms virtual machine.
Keep in mind that the temporary storage you get with this instance is only short-term storage meant for page files and swap files, which is extra RAM that is used by the operating system. So, you’ll need to pay extra for storage with all of these instances – but you can buy just as much or as little as you need in HDD or SSD format, depending on your budget and requirements.
A-series virtual machines are not burstable and are meant for websites with low-to-moderate levels of consistent site traffic.
A1 v2 is suitable for web servers with up to 50,000 monthly site visitors, or 600,000 annual visitors.
This would be a very good option if you’re hosting multiple sites that get predictable traffic numbers, like e-commerce sites with only a few products each that aren’t generally affected by sale announcements.
Any site can experience surges in traffic, and while these VMs probably wouldn’t be slowed down by the usual fluctuations in your visitor count,
you might have to upgrade if you do start to see viral traffic loads.
A2 v2 takes the specs from A1 v2 and doubles them. That means you’re getting 2 CPU cores, 4GB of RAM, and 10GB of temporary storage.
A2 v2 can support between up to 100,000 monthly visitors, or around 1.2 million annual visitors. Examples of sites with this level of traffic could be niche product affiliate marketing or review websites. The traffic for these types of sites tends to increase gradually over time, and doesn’t necessarily surge very often.
Is Microsoft Azure Cloud Hosting Right for You?
Azure cloud hosting in the form of Linux or Windows virtual machines is ideal for web servers of various sizes and a multitude of website types for up to around 100,000 monthly site visitors.
If you’re looking to launch large, mission-critical websites or a growing and diverse reselling operation, Microsoft Azure’s dedicated servers will be more appropriate to your needs. In any instance, you can always start small and upgrade as necessary.
Dedicated Servers
Microsoft Azure’s
dedicated server hardware is not shared with other customers unlike standard virtual machines, so you’ll have total access and complete control over what goes on them. They’re also far cheaper to maintain than on-premises physical servers.
Dedicated servers also offer the potential for excellent performance, so long as you know how to configure them. Even with Azure’s top-end support, you’ll need someone on your team who can manage a server.
DCsv2-Type 1 is the cheapest dedicated server that Microsoft Azure offers. It’s powerful enough to support a fairly large entertainment, media, or news website with up to around 5 million monthly site visitors.
If you need to serve a lot of simultaneous e-commerce transactions, or otherwise get a lot of interactive site traffic, this will also work for that purpose. It will handle large volumes of operations like logins and sales – but again, it must be configured correctly.
Fsv2-Type2 gives you twelve times more CPU cores and nearly two-and-a-half times more RAM. This dedicated configuration will serve up to around 12 million monthly visitors, depending on your site’s content.
However, keep in mind that very complex interactive or high-quality video will increase the load on the server and requirements for RAM and bandwidth.
When you get to this level, it’s imperative to monitor your site’s activity at all times. A surge in traffic can bring your site down, cost you thousands of dollars more, or – ideally – be a sign that your business is booming, as intended. Maintenance and monitoring are thus essential.
The Msv2MedMem-Type 1 memory-optimized dedicated server is suitable for extreme levels of traffic. For example, this means you could host multiple entertainment, media, news, and e-commerce websites with total site traffic of up to around 50 million monthly visitors.
Each time your site visitors log in or make purchases simultaneously, more memory will be required. If you don’t choose a high-memory dedicated host in these instances, your website’s performance could slow down or shut down entirely for a short period if too many users try to do too many things at the same time.
Again, monitoring and maintenance is essential, so that you can adjust individual resource levels to ensure the most cost-effective server configuration for your purposes at any given moment.
If you’re in this echelon of hosting customers, you’re probably also well-advised to pay extra for top-end Azure support.
Is Microsoft Azure Dedicated Hosting Right for You?
If your web server is observing more than 5 million monthly site visitors, or you’re planning to resell hosting to multiple blue-chip clients, dedicated hosting will be your best bet.
Microsoft Azure also happens to be one of the most competitively-priced options in this space.
Recommended Microsoft Azure Alternatives
Though Microsoft Azure is a known and respected cloud hosting platform, it may not have the specific combination of features you need at a price that’s reasonable for you. Therefore, I’ve recommended some alternatives below.
In our performance testing, Kamatera consistently scored very highly. And yes, it even (surprisingly) exceeded the performance of Microsoft Azure. In some instances, it’s even been proven to be as much as two or three times as fast.
But where Kamatera really shines is in its ability to offer similar services and features at a lower price than Microsoft Azure. And on top of that, Kamatera’s level of server customization is unmatched by most cloud hosting providers. Kamatera lets you fine-tune RAM, CPU, and SSD space to an even greater degree than Azure.
Liquid Web’s hosting services are managed, which means that
you do not have to worry about the setup, administration, and management of your virtual instance. It offers cloud-based hosting aimed at small-to-medium-sized businesses (SMBs), most of which is organized into straightforward plans rather than infinitely-customizable mega-servers.
Additionally, all of Liquid Web’s hosting plans come with free, 24/7 support via tickets, phone, and chat. Microsoft Azure of course does offer 24/7 support, but live phone and chat support costs extra.
Cloudways does not have its own servers or data centers – it provides managed hosting on existing infrastructure from DigitalOcean, Linode, Vultr, Amazon Web Services (AWS), or Google Compute Engine (GCE).
Cloudways provides security, performance, and configures the hosting technology stack to align with your chosen platform. The pricing differs depending on the vendor, with costs generally higher across the board due to the premium associated with the managed service. If you require it, the investment is worthwhile.
Cloudways offers a 3-day free trial in case you want to try its technology stack risk-free.
Render is a competitively-priced cloud computing platform with straightforward plans.
It is specifically geared towards developers, with support for programming languages like Rust, Ruby, Node.js, Elixir, Go, and Python.
It also offers a free plan so you can try the service. This includes 512MB of RAM, a shared CPU, and 750 hours of server running time per month – and you can track usage in your account dashboard on the billing page.
Amazon Web Services is one of the most trusted cloud computing services today, and it’s one of Microsoft Azure’s primary competitors with various factors helping its cause significantly. For example, AWS includes 100GB of storage with your plan.
AWS also offers free services for one year, including a t2.micro general-purpose server instance which includes one CPU, and 1GB of RAM. You could also opt for a 90-day free trial of Amazon Lightsail, which is a virtual private server (VPS) with 750 hours of free running time. Finally, AWS’s always-free CloudFront content delivery network includes 1TB of outbound traffic.
Google Cloud is a compelling alternative to Microsoft Azure as it offers less expensive persistent disk storage. Also, some may find Google Cloud’s platform to be somewhat easier to use than Azure, yet it offers a similarly enormous range of cloud-based computing services.
GCP also offers a 90-day free trial with a $300 credit that you can use towards things like upgrading the amount of persistent storage and the number of CPUs. Plus, there is an always-free e2-micro VM instance with 0.25 CPUs and 1GB of RAM, and its free usage limits include 30GB of storage, and 1GB of network traffic.
So, Is Microsoft Azure Really The Best Cloud Hosting Service?
It’s hard to say which of these types of services is “the best,” because performance will depend heavily on the skills of your web development team, and price will depend heavily on the requirements of your project. Suffice it to say,
Many big companies use and trust Azure, so you probably won’t go wrong with this service – but keep an eye on the cost of persistent storage.
B-series virtual machines give your web server the flexibility to handle consistent traffic, and ramp up when needed. The memory optimization of B1ms can enable your web server to handle periodic bumps in traffic and many simultaneous site actions like log-ins and purchases.
Azure’s dedicated servers are meant for very high levels of site traffic and give you the most flexibility and control. You could go with the Fsv2-Type2 dedicated server as a decent middle-of-the-road option if your site observes up to around 10 million monthly visitors.
If you want even more flexibility and the ability to fine-tune your service on a minute-to-minute basis, and you don’t need any of the advanced cloud computing services on offer from Azure, Kamatera might be a better option for you.
Finally, if the whole process of customizing, configuring, and maintaining a server seems too onerous, you can opt for a managed cloud hosting plan from Liquid Web. This should appeal to you if your online operations are smaller and less complex, and you don’t want to have to retain a developer.
FAQ
Does Microsoft Azure offer a free trial or a free account?
Microsoft Azure offers an opportunity to try its platform with a number of services that are free for a year or for 750 hours (whichever comes first), along with a $200 credit. These free services include a B1s burstable Windows or Linux virtual machine, and two 64GB persistent storage disks (which usually incur an additional charge). The $200 credit can also be used to pay for any other Azure add-ons you want to try out.
Or, if you’ve decided that a fully-customizable option is overkill for your current needs, check out our step-by-step guide to choosing a standard web host and launching your first website.
What can I do with my $200 Microsoft Azure credit?
After you sign up for an account, you can apply your $200 credit towards any products and services you want, including more persistent storage, or another burstable server instance. Just keep in mind that adding resources could deplete this credit more quickly than you might expect, and that it is only valid for 30 days from the time you sign up.
How does Microsoft Azure invoice customers?
With Microsoft Azure, the way you’re charged depends on your subscription model. You can either pay as you go so you pay for only what you use, or you can sign up for a one- or three-year reserved term with fixed prices.
If you pay as you go, Azure measures the resources that you use and bills you accordingly each month. Reserved terms will cost you the same amount each month, and are usually cheaper in the long run, but you’ll need some idea of the resources you expect your website will require over an extended period of time.
How many pricing models does Microsoft Azure offer?
Microsoft Azure offers three primary billing models: pay-as-you-go, 1-year reserved, and 3-year reserved. Opting for the three-year option will get you the best price.
If you’re looking for more options, be sure to have a look at our list of the top 10 web hosting providers for 2024 before making a final decision.
Does Microsoft Azure offer 24/7 customer support?
All of Microsoft Azure’s plans offer basic customer support. This allows you to contact somebody via a ticketing system regarding issues related to the management of your account.
The free basic tier also gives you access to Azure Advisor which Microsoft Azure defines as a “cloud consultant.” Your server deployment is thereby analyzed using several data points, and recommendations are made regarding how to improve it.
In order to get access to 24/7 technical support via chat and phone, you’ll have to upgrade to one of the paid support plans, which vary greatly in price.